Firefox IndexedDB Vulnerability Allows Cross-Origin Tracking
A vulnerability in Firefox and Tor Browser allows websites to link user identities across private sessions using a stable identifier derived from IndexedDB ordering. Mozilla has released a fix in Firefox 150 and ESR 140.10.0 to canonicalize the database list order.
